I fished the SA Sharkskin in WF4F on a Sage 490-4 XP last weekend.
It is an excellent line, the noise goes away in 5-10 minutes and it makes much less noise when wet vs. fly shop parking lot/grass casting. The textured surface also feels different when wet.
The line does float higher and is easier to lift from the water surface.
When the water logged leader pulls the tip under, a quick wipe with paper towel will enable the tip to float for another hour.
I cast the line with emergers, nymphs & split shot and streamers,,,,,,it is a similar taper to the original Mastery Distance line (pre XPS GPS, XXD etc). SA will introduce DT, Nymph and other tapers in due time.
The line excells at mending and easy effortless pickup & casting, this is more important to me than distance.
Is the line worth $100 retail, for me yes, if it will give us 3x life compared to the other high end lines (presently at $65 retail).
